## Deployment

Crumbline's order-cutoff service enforces the rule that bakery orders placed after the daily cutoff roll to the next production day. Deploys go through the Ovenrail pipeline; the release manager tags a version and the pipeline handles blue-green swapping. Cutoff times are timezone-aware and read at startup, so a restart is required after any change. Rollbacks simply re-tag the prior version. The service starts with the configuration values below.

deployment values, bagap-kagaf:
[wenmir]
port = 5432
team = frair
host = wenmir.zarqelnet.test
region = east-4
access_code = ac_b2428f
timeout_ms = 500

## Capacity note: sort stability in Quillform reports

For review: Quillform's report builder switched from an unstable in-place sort to a stable merge variant so grouped rows keep their ingest order across re-renders. The memory cost is roughly one extra buffer per sorted column, which matters once report width crosses the Delvane cluster's per-worker ceiling. We cap concurrent sorts and spill to disk past a row threshold rather than risk eviction. The buffer sizes, spill threshold, and concurrency cap we settled on are as follows.

tuning constants:
QUOTAS = {
    "druwyn": 5,
    "holix": 5,
    "zorath": 5,
    "holwyn": 10,
}

**Changelog — StormRelay fan-out v4.1**

Defaults changed. Fan-out batch size dropped from 500 to 200 recipients per push to reduce tail latency during county-wide alerts. Retry window shortened to 90 seconds. Dedup cache TTL doubled. No action needed for existing deployments; new installs pick these up automatically. Questions go to the StormRelay channel. The new default configuration values follow.

deployment values, yadug-bawif:
[framir]
team = pelox
access_code = ac_a38ab2
owner = tamion.julael
host = framir.tolvaqlabs.test
port = 11211
peer = tammir.zemvargrid.local
salt = 2215ef03
pin = 1541